This past Friday we spent another day working on range, median, and mode.  The Range is the difference between the greatest number and the least number.  The Median is the number in the middle.  The Mode is the number that appears the most often.  Your child brought home a review sheet on this last Thursday in their binder.  By Friday, it was easy breezy for us to find these three things.
